The yield on Indonesia 3 Year Bond Yield eased to 5.12% on February 2, 2026, marking a 0.02 percentage points decrease from the previous session. Over the past month, the yield has fallen by 0.09 points and is 1.97 points lower than a year ago, according to over-the-counter interbank yield quotes for this government bond maturity.
Historically, the Indonesia 3 Year Note Yield reached an all time high of 19.13 in November of 2008. This page includes a chart with historical data for Indonesia 3Y. Indonesia 3 Year Note Yield - data, forecasts, historical chart - was last updated on February 2 of 2026.
The Indonesia 3 Year Note Yield is expected to trade at 5.07 % by the end of this quarter, according to Trading Economics global macro models and analysts expectations. Looking forward, we estimate it to trade at 4.78 in 12 months time.
